.DISCUSSION...
Issued at 430 AM MDT Tue Apr 16 2024
The upper level storm system that brought us the wind and dust on
Monday has moved off to our east and a quieter weather pattern has
settled across the region. Yesterday`s system has swept in some
cooler air, so our high temperatures today will be 5 to 7 degrees
cooler than we saw on Monday. For today aloft, we will have a
zonal (west to east) flow pattern which will keep us dry with
mostly clear skies. A weak upper level short wave will move across
New Mexico on Wednesday. This system has little dynamics and next
to no moisture to work with, so the only result of the trough
sliding by will be some breezy afternoon winds and our high
temperatures jumping a little above average. For Thursday and
Friday, we will see a continuation of the zonal flow aloft, which
will keep our high temperatures above average and give us breezy
afternoon winds.
For next weekend, we will see an upper level trough approach the
region from the west, while at the same time moisture from the
east will try and push into the region. While Saturday is only
showing a 20 to 30% chance that the 40 degree dewpoint line will
push into the Rio Grande Valley, that percentage rises to 40 to
50% on Sunday. For now I have limited the rain and thunderstorms
chances for this weekend mainly to locations east of El Paso and
in the Sacramento Mountains. But we will need to watch how
subsequent models handle this dry line intrusion over the next
couple of days. If the deeper moisture can push further to the
west we will have to spread our thunderstorm chances further west
as well. For the start of next week, things look dry and continued
warm with high temperatures above average.

.FIRE WEATHER...
Issued at 430 AM MDT Tue Apr 16 2024
We will see quieter fire weather conditions this week. Min RH`s
today through Friday will continue to be very dry with min RH`s in
the single digits in the lowlands and near 10% in area mountains.
Nightly RH recoveries will be poor with lowland values of 10 to
20% and mountain values of 20 to 30%. Ours this week will be a
little breezy each afternoon (it is April after all), but the
winds will stay below critical levels. Vent rates the next couple
of days will range from very good to excellent.
